Introduction: Understanding the Basics of Car Collecting

The Appeal of Car Collecting

Car collecting is a hobby that has been around for as long as cars themselves. From vintage models to modern supercars, car collectors are passionate about owning and maintaining their vehicles, often spending thousands of dollars on maintenance and restoration. But what is it that makes car collecting so appealing? For many, it’s the thrill of owning a piece of history, while for others it’s the thrill of driving a rare and unique vehicle. Whatever the reason, car collecting is a hobby that continues to attract enthusiasts from all over the world.

The Different Types of Car Collections

Car collections can vary widely depending on the collector’s interests and budget. Some collectors focus on a specific brand or model, while others collect cars from a certain era or country. From classic American muscle cars to rare European sports cars, there’s a car collection for everyone.

The Value of Car Collections

The value of car collections can vary widely depending on a number of factors such as rarity, condition, and demand. While some cars can sell for millions of dollars at auction, others may only be worth a few thousand dollars. It’s important to do your research before buying a car collection to ensure that you’re getting a fair price.

Advantages and Disadvantages of Cars Collection for Sale

Advantages of Cars Collection for Sale

There are many advantages to owning a car collection, including:

1. Investment Potential

Cars can be a great investment, with many cars appreciating in value over time. Buying a car collection can be a smart investment for the future.

2. Unique and Rare Cars

Owning a car collection allows you to own unique and rare cars that you might not be able to find on the open market.

3. Pride of Ownership

Owning a car collection can be a source of pride and enjoyment, allowing you to show off your cars and share your passion with others.

4. Networking Opportunities

Car collecting can be a great way to meet other enthusiasts and make new connections in the automotive industry.

Disadvantages of Cars Collection for Sale

While there are many advantages to owning a car collection, there are also some potential drawbacks to consider, including:

1. High Cost

Buying and maintaining a car collection can be extremely expensive, with some collections costing millions of dollars.

2. Maintenance and Upkeep

Maintaining and restoring a car collection can be time-consuming and expensive, requiring a lot of time and effort to keep your cars in top condition.

3. Storage and Display Space

Storing and displaying a car collection can be a challenge, requiring a lot of space and potentially leading to storage fees or other costs.

4. Limited Use

While you may love your car collection, you may not be able to drive all of your cars regularly, leading to limited use and potentially reduced enjoyment of your collection.

Cars Collection for Sale Table

Car Model
Year
Condition
Price
Ferrari 250 GTO
1962
Restored
$48,400,000
Ford GT40
1966
Original
$5,500,000
Lamborghini Miura
1967
Restored
$2,500,000
Porsche 911 Carrera RS 2.7
1973
Original
$1,500,000
Aston Martin DB5
1964
Restored
$1,400,000
Mercedes-Benz 300SL Gullwing
1955
Restored
$1,100,000
Chevrolet Corvette Stingray
1967
Original
$550,000
Dodge Charger R/T
1969
Restored
$250,000
